Crack The champagne McClaren & Allardyce Are Out

Blackburn Rovers WILL NOT be managed by Steve McClaren OR Sam Allardyce next season as one has been confirmed as the manager of FC Twente, with the other withdrawing from the race.

It might not be known who the new manager at Ewood Park will be (however, Paul Ince and Michael Laudrup are understood to be leading this race) but we now know that it won't be McClaren, as the former England manager has taken over the Dutch club on a two-year contract and Allardyce has withdrawn from the running according to early reports this morning on Sky Sports.

Most of us were PRAYING that McClaren wouldn't get the job, with more than a fair few also hoping this about Allardyce as well, but with Stevie Mac reported as having turned down the Twente job recently in favour of the Rovers position we were worried, but we are now safe so the champagne can be cracked open. News shortly after that Allardyce had also officially ruled himself out has brightened my day!!!
